The varsity girls basketball team played an overtime thriller for the district championship. The varsity boys basketball team will look to capture its third straight district title. Here is your Weekend Raider Update for March 6, 2023.

Girls Basketball
The varsity girls basketball team played an overtime thriller for the Class 4 District 14 championship Saturday, March 4, at St. Michael the Archangel. The #2-seeded Raiders battled the top-seeded St. Michael Guardians throughout the game, ultimately falling, 79-75, and taking second place. 

Four players scored in double figures, led by Kenedy Nutter's 27 points. Ava Rasmus grabbed nine rebounds and had six assists in the game.

To get to the championship game, the Raiders defeated Odessa, 73-28, in the district semifinals.

Boys Basketball
The top-seeded varsity boys basketball team will play in the Class 5 District 8 championship game tonight, March 6, against Smithville at Platte County High School. The game begins at 6 p.m. Platte County is selling digital tickets only (for those 6 years old and older) through MSHSAA. Tickets are $6 plus a service fee. The game will also be live streamed through MSHSAA TV for a fee.

The team won its district semifinal game Friday, March 3, against a tough Van Horn squad, 49-36. Devin Conley led the Raiders in scoring with 25 points. Darin Conley added another double-double, 10 points and 11 rebounds, in the victory. The team also defeated East (KC) High School in its quarterfinal matchup, 77-42.

Winter Sports Awards Program
Winter sports student athletes will be celebrated at the annual winter sports awards program next Wednesday, March 8, at 7 p.m., in Hall Student Center Auditorium.
